Viewing 2 posts - 1 through 2 (of 2 total) Author Posts April 3, 2023 at 2:49 pm #2595367 Daniel I would like to adjust the styling of my blogs category pages, but I can’t figure out how. https://climbingjunkie.com/ I want to display posts only in a specific category on these category pages in a post grid. When I am on the category page, I only get the option to edit the category and not the page. https://imgur.com/a/QcYi0km How can I edit the grid’s functions, styling, and add other content to the page? April 3, 2023 at 6:43 pm #2595488 Fernando Customer Support Hi Daniel, You can edit the Archive pages through Appearance > Customize > Layout > Blog. Reference: https://docs.generatepress.com/article/blog-overview/ As for how the posts appear on the Archive page, you can use a Block Element – Content Template.
